  • Patent number: 11213971
    Abstract: Blade guards for power tools such as table saws are disclosed. The blade guard may include a guard that pivots up and down to allow a workpiece to move past the guard, a dust collection channel, and a pivot mechanism which maintains the dust collection channel in an operable condition as the guard pivots up or down. The guard may also function as a wood stop and it may include anti-kickback pawls. The blade guard may be part of a dust collection system and may be connected to a vacuum system by a conduit such as a flexible hose.

  • Patent number: 10029385
    Abstract: A hold down mechanism for a bandsaw including an upstream wheel positioned upstream of the saw blade and a downstream wheel positioned downstream of the saw blade, each wheel being rotationally connected to a bogie which is in turn supported on a swing arm. The proximity of the upstream and downstream wheels to the saw blade as well as the degree of pivoting motion permitted by the bogie enable a hold down wheel to press the ends if sequential workpieces against a base as the ends pass the saw blade to assure a uniform thickness of the cut workpiece. An angled guide surface is provide upstream from the forward wheel to assist the forward wheel in elevating when a trailing workpiece is significantly thicker than the workpiece preceding.

  • Patent number: 8272305
    Abstract: Present invention teaches to build a woodworking table saw where, a splitter/riving knife move with the saw blade in a synchronized manner, with an idle gear engaging in planetary circular action around a fixed quadrant gear and the outer gear teeth portion of a support arm, so that any height adjustment or angle tilting done to the saw blade will result in the same movement of the splitter/riving knife, maintaining the constant linear difference (usually 5 mm) between the saw blade and the splitter/riving knife. In addition, to facilitate the installation, changeover, and/or removal of the splitter/riving knife, a spring pressure plate mechanism is used, along with lug bolts and a spring loaded secure pin device to easily set the splitter/riving knife in a pre-set position without using tools and in shorter time duration.
